Standard Amino Acids
The 20 amino acids that are encoded by the standard genetic code, integral to biological processes as the building blocks of proteins.
Side Chain
The part of a molecule that is attached to a core structure and varies among molecules of the same class, influencing the properties of the molecule.
Asparagine
A type of amino acid that plays a vital role in the biosynthesis of proteins.
Hydrolyzed
The chemical process in which a molecule is split into two parts by the addition of a water molecule, often breaking down polymers into monomers.
